ABOUT US

The Hatter Cardiovascular Institute at UCL has been awarded a 3 year British Heart Foundation grant and are seeking a postdoctoral research fellow, with speciific interest in neuroprotection, relating to ischaemic stroke.

Responsibilities:

Applications are invited for a Research Fellow post funded by a British Heart Foundation grant, investigating ways of protecting the brain from injury in the setting of ischaemia-reperfusion injury. The research programme will specifically focus on the phosphoinositide 3-kinase (PI3K)/AKT signalling pathway and investigates the neuroprotective effect of a novel, UCL-developed compound utilising an in vivo Middle Cerebral Artery Occlusion (MCAO) stroke model to determine associated pathways involved in the PI3K/AKT pathway in stroke. You will work closely with basic and clinical scientists.
